M-22: A Lake Michigan Lover's Dream


If there's one drive that records the significance of Michigan's charm, it's M-22. This route winds along the Lake Michigan coastline and with the Sleeping Bear Dunes National Lakeshore. The views are motion picture-- towering dunes, sprawling wineries, quaint harbor communities, and sparkling blue water that seems to take place permanently.

The Tunnel of Trees: A Canopy of Natural Wonder


The Tunnel of Trees, formally called M-119, is more than simply a drive-- it's an experience. Running along Lake Michigan's northeastern side from Harbor Springs to Cross Village, this narrow roadway is covered in a thick canopy of wood trees that rupture right into flaming reds, oranges, and yellows each autumn.

US-2 Across the Upper Peninsula: Untamed and Unforgettable


Cross the renowned Mackinac Bridge and you'll find yourself in Michigan's wilder side-- the Upper Peninsula. US-2 takes you west along the Lake Michigan shoreline, where the views really feel unblemished and raw. Pine forests stretch for miles, freshwater coastlines glimmer in the sun, and roadside pull-offs expose remote gems.


It's a best course for those that appreciate the trip as long as the destination. The Copper Country Trail: History Meets Rugged Beauty


For something genuinely off the beaten path, the Copper Country Trail in the Keweenaw Peninsula provides a mix of natural beauty and abundant heritage. This stretch winds with old mining towns, dense woodlands, and cliffside searches that use sweeping views of Lake Superior.

Bluewater Highway: The Coastal Route Through Eastern Michigan


On the east side of the state, the Bluewater Highway (M-25) traces the contour of Lake Huron. Beginning near Port Huron and taking a trip north to Bay City, this drive showcases lighthouses, coastal communities, and endless views of freshwater waves.
